Frequently Asked Questions about Gainesville Apartments with Swimming Pool

What is the Cheapest Swimming Pool apartment in Gainesville?

Currently the most affordable Apartment in Gainesville with Swimming Pool is at University Terrace West listed at $440.

How much is the average rent for Gainesville Apartments with Swimming Pool?

The average rent for a Apartment in Gainesville with Swimming Pool is $1,494.

What is the largest Gainesville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?

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in Gainesville is a 3,100 square feet unit starting from $829 at The Ridge.

What is the average size for Gainesville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?

The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in Gainesville is currently at 733 sq ft.
